Mark Allen interviews Matt Alberts in the latest edition of KC ART NEWS, an InformalityBlog exclusive.
“All the subjects are those who have dedicated their lives to skateboarding,” Says Alberts, a Denver-based wet collodion plate photographer. “Collodion is only sensitive to UV light, so it has the ability to see the person beneath the skin.”
[videoembed type=”youtube” url=”https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=v4evZZE9LQI”]
Matt Alberts is on a journey from Denver to New York City, with his camera, his chemicals, and his passion for documenting the American subculture of skateboarding communities. His latest stop is Kansas City:
“I had no idea KC would be so rad!” remarks Alberts.
“LIFERS” is on view at Escapist Skateboards on Southwest Boulevard. More information can be found at www.thelifersproject.tumblr.com
